Presentation Transcript


  1. GEMS Sunday Litany

  2. Leader:Philippians 4:8 is God’s “right thinking” list for you and me. Will you read it aloud with me? ALL:Finally, brothers and sisters, whatever is true, whatever is noble, whatever is right, whatever is pure, whatever is lovely, whatever is admirable – if anything is excellent or praiseworthy – think about such things (Philippians 4:8).

  3. GEMS:We need to fight for our minds, and fighting starts with thinking about what we think about!

  4. Leader: God tells us to continuously reflect on and guard our thought lives because our minds are launch pads for our words and actions. To become the people God wants us to be, He commands us to love Him with our hearts and minds and to set our minds on what He desires.

  5. Congregation:Those who live according to the sinful nature have their minds set on what the nature desires; but those who live in accordance to the Spirit have their minds set on what the Spirit desires (Romans 8:5).

  6. GEMS:We need to fight for right thinking by testing every thought to the truth of God’s Word!

  7. Leader:There is a right and good way to think. In the Bible God teaches us to evaluate all our thoughts. When our thoughts don’t line up with Scripture, we are to trade-in those negative thoughts for right-thinking thoughts.

  8. Congregation:We demolish arguments and every pretension that sets itself up against the knowledge of God, and we take captive every thought to make it obedient to Christ (2 Corinthians 10:5).

  9. ALL:Heavenly Father, thank You that Your Son Jesus is the only true hope and victory for right thinking and right living. Teach us to take captive every thought and make it obedient to You. In Jesus’ name, Amen.
